Music talent agent among dead after jet crashes into San Diego neighborhood : NPR

SAN DIEGO — A tragic incident unfolded early Thursday as a private jet carrying a music talent agent and five others crashed into a San Diego neighborhood after hitting a power line in foggy weather. The impact resulted in the loss of multiple lives on board the flight.

The devastating crash caused a home to catch fire, leading to explosions and the ignition of several vehicles in the neighborhood. Residents in the area, located in U.S. Navy-owned housing, were startled awake by the loud crash and fire, witnessing a scene of chaos and destruction.

San Diego Police Chief Scott Wahl described the horrific scene, stating, “I can’t quite put words to describe what the scene looks like, but with the jet fuel going down the street, and everything on fire all at once, it was pretty horrific to see.”

Although no residents in the neighborhood lost their lives, eight individuals were hospitalized for smoke inhalation and non-life-threatening injuries. Among the casualties were Dave Shapiro, co-founder of Sound Talent Group, and two employees, who were on board the ill-fated flight.

The tragic event has left the music agency devastated, with the agency expressing condolences to the families affected by the tragedy.
